Title: Web Trails
Subjects: Language Arts, Educational Technology, Geography
Grade Levels: 6-8, 9-12
Brief Description: Students research Iowa's parks and trails, plan a day trip to one of the places they learn about, and write a fiction story based on the information they find.
Objectives: Students will demonstrate the ability to work in groups, use online resources, and write a fiction story based on real information.
Key Concepts: hiking, recreation, WebQuest, online research, creative writing
Materials Needed: Computer with Internet access, the http://www.linnmar.k12.ia.us/schools/novak/webquest/webtrails.html Web Trails WebQuest, additional online resources
Lesson Plan: Using the guide questions provided and World Wide Web resources, students plan a hiking trip in Iowa. The entire http://www.linnmar.k12.ia.us/schools/novak/webquest/webtrails.html Web Trails WebQuest can be found online. Use it as is or adapt the lessons, activities, and printable worksheets to create a WebQuest about your own state.
Assessment: Assessment criteria, worksheets, and rubrics are available online.
